OpendTect  6.3
Public Types | Public Member Functions | Public Attributes | Protected Member Functions | Protected Attributes | List of all members
uiFlatViewColTabEd Class Reference

FlatView color table editor. More...

Inheritance diagram for uiFlatViewColTabEd:
[legend]

Public Types

typedef FlatView::DataDispPars::VD VDDispPars
 

Public Member Functions

 uiFlatViewColTabEd (uiColTabToolBar &)
 
 ~uiFlatViewColTabEd ()
 
uiColTabSelToolselTool ()
 
void setSensitive (bool yn)
 
const VDDispParsdisplayPars () const
 
VDDispParsdisplayPars ()
 
void setDisplayPars (const VDDispPars &)
 
- Public Member Functions inherited from CallBacker
 CallBacker ()
 
 CallBacker (const CallBacker &)
 
virtual ~CallBacker ()
 
bool attachCB (const NotifierAccess &, const CallBack &, bool onlyifnew=false) const
 
bool attachCB (const NotifierAccess *notif, const CallBack &cb, bool onlyifnew=false) const
 
void detachCB (const NotifierAccess &, const CallBack &) const
 
void detachCB (const NotifierAccess *notif, const CallBack &cb) const
 
bool isNotifierAttached (const NotifierAccess *) const
 Only for debugging purposes, don't use. More...
 
virtual bool isCapsule () const
 
void stopReceivingNotifications () const
 

Public Attributes

Notifier< uiFlatViewColTabEdrefreshReq
 
Notifier< uiFlatViewColTabEdcolTabChgd
 

Protected Member Functions

void mapperChgCB (CallBacker *)
 
void seqChgCB (CallBacker *)
 
void refreshReqCB (CallBacker *)
 
- Protected Member Functions inherited from CallBacker
void detachAllNotifiers () const
 Call from the destructor of your inherited object. More...
 

Protected Attributes

uiColTabSelToolctseltool_
 
FlatView::DataDispPars::VD vdpars_
 

Additional Inherited Members

- Static Public Member Functions inherited from CallBacker
static void createReceiverForCurrentThread ()
 
static void removeReceiverForCurrentThread ()
 

Detailed Description

FlatView color table editor.

Member Typedef Documentation

Constructor & Destructor Documentation

uiFlatViewColTabEd::uiFlatViewColTabEd ( uiColTabToolBar )
uiFlatViewColTabEd::~uiFlatViewColTabEd ( )

Member Function Documentation

const VDDispPars& uiFlatViewColTabEd::displayPars ( ) const
inline
VDDispPars& uiFlatViewColTabEd::displayPars ( )
inline
void uiFlatViewColTabEd::mapperChgCB ( CallBacker )
protected
void uiFlatViewColTabEd::refreshReqCB ( CallBacker )
protected
uiColTabSelTool& uiFlatViewColTabEd::selTool ( )
inline
void uiFlatViewColTabEd::seqChgCB ( CallBacker )
protected
void uiFlatViewColTabEd::setDisplayPars ( const VDDispPars )
void uiFlatViewColTabEd::setSensitive ( bool  yn)

Member Data Documentation

Notifier<uiFlatViewColTabEd> uiFlatViewColTabEd::colTabChgd
uiColTabSelTool& uiFlatViewColTabEd::ctseltool_
protected
Notifier<uiFlatViewColTabEd> uiFlatViewColTabEd::refreshReq
FlatView::DataDispPars::VD uiFlatViewColTabEd::vdpars_
protected

Generated at for the OpendTect seismic interpretation project. Copyright (C): dGB Beheer B. V. 2017